What is the Event Cancellation/Non-Appearance Application?
The Event Cancellation/Non-Appearance Application serves a vital role for individuals or organizations in Massachusetts who face potential cancellations due to unforeseen circumstances. This application provides essential coverage for event cancellations and acts as a non-appearance insurance form.
Typically used by event organizers and planners, the form operates by requiring detailed information about the event, the applicant's involvement, and any associated risks. By completing this form, applicants can mitigate financial loss in the event of a cancellation.
Purpose and Benefits of the Event Cancellation/Non-Appearance Application
Having insurance coverage for event cancellations or non-appearances is crucial. The event insurance application provides peace of mind, allowing organizers to focus on planning rather than worrying about unexpected events that could disrupt their schedules.
This application offers significant benefits by providing financial protection against unforeseen circumstances, ensuring that organizers can recover costs related to venue deposits, vendor payments, and other expenses incurred when an event cannot proceed as planned.

Required Documents and Information You'll Need to Gather
Before starting the application process, it's essential to gather the following documents:
-
Event contract or agreement
-
Invoice details for any prior payments
-
Proof of event location
-
Contact information for vendors and suppliers
Creating a checklist can help ensure that all required materials are gathered, making the process of filling out the cancellation insurance template more efficient.

What information do I need to fill out the form?
You will need details about the event such as the name, date, location, and a description of your involvement. Gather any relevant risks or considerations to include in the application.
Is there a deadline for submitting my application?
It is recommended to submit your application as soon as you are aware of a potential cancellation or non-appearance, as each policy may have specific deadlines for claim submissions.
Do I need to provide supporting documents?
Typically, supporting documents may include contracts, event details, and evidence of costs incurred due to the cancellation. Check with your insurance provider for exact requirements.
